How to Choose the Right Microfiber Cleaning Cloth for Streak‑Free Shine and Long‑Lasting Performance?

Why Microfiber Has Revolutionized Cleaning

If you have ever struggled with lint, streaks, or scratches while cleaning, you already know the frustration of using the wrong cloth. Traditional cotton rags, paper towels, and sponges often leave behind residue, fibers, or even damage delicate surfaces. The solution that has transformed the cleaning industry is the microfiber cleaning cloth. Made from ultra‑fine synthetic fibers—typically a blend of polyester and polyamide—microfiber cloths are engineered to trap dirt, absorb liquids, and polish surfaces without scratching. They are now the go‑to choice for professional cleaners, automotive detailers, opticians, and homeowners alike.

But not all microfiber cloths are created equal. With different weaves, weights, and intended uses, selecting the right cloth can be confusing. This guide cuts through the marketing hype and gives you practical, evidence‑based advice on how to choose, use, and care for microfiber cleaning cloths. Whether you are cleaning glass, electronics, cars, or kitchen counters, you will learn exactly which cloth to reach for and why.

What Makes Microfiber Different from Cotton or Paper Towels?

The secret to microfiber's cleaning power lies in its construction. Microfiber fibers are typically less than one denier in diameter—about 1/100th the thickness of a human hair. This incredible fineness allows the fibers to penetrate microscopic surface pores and crevices that cotton or paper towels simply cannot reach. When you drag a microfiber cloth across a surface, the fibers act like tiny fingers, lifting and trapping dirt, dust, and grease.

Another key feature is the split‑fiber design. High‑quality microfiber is made from a blend of polyester and polyamide (nylon) that is split during manufacturing, creating multiple tiny wedges that increase the cloth's surface area by up to 40 times. This structure creates a static charge that attracts dust like a magnet, holding particles until the cloth is washed. In contrast, cotton fibers are round and smooth, which means they simply push dirt around rather than capturing it.

Studies have shown that microfiber cloths can remove up to 99% of bacteria from surfaces using only water, outperforming cotton cloths and even many chemical cleaners. This is why hospitals and food processing facilities are increasingly adopting microfiber for sanitization.

Microfiber Cloth Types: What Do the Numbers and Colors Mean?

When shopping for microfiber cloths, you will encounter terms like "200 GSM," "300 GSM," "80/20 blend," and various color codes. Understanding these metrics helps you choose the right cloth for your specific task.

GSM: Weight Matters

GSM stands for grams per square meter, a measure of cloth density. A higher GSM generally means a thicker, more absorbent cloth, while lower GSM cloths are thinner and better for polishing.

Low GSM (80‑120 GSM): These are lightweight, thin cloths ideal for polishing glass, mirrors, and screens. They leave no lint and are excellent for final buffing.

Medium GSM (200‑250 GSM): The most versatile range, suitable for general cleaning, dusting, and drying. They offer a good balance of absorbency and scrubbing power.

High GSM (300‑400 GSM): Thick, plush cloths that are highly absorbent and great for heavy‑duty tasks like drying cars, cleaning spills, or applying and removing polishes.

Very High GSM (400+): Premium cloths for professional detailing and industrial applications; they offer maximum absorbency and softness.

Blend Ratios

Most microfiber cloths are made from a mix of polyester (for scrubbing and durability) and polyamide (for absorbency). The most common ratio is 80% polyester / 20% polyamide. Cloths with a higher polyester content are better for scrubbing, while higher polyamide increases absorbency. For general use, the 80/20 blend is a safe bet.

Color Coding

Many commercial cleaning operations use color‑coded microfiber cloths to prevent cross‑contamination. A typical scheme might be:

  • Blue: General cleaning
  • Green: Kitchen and food surfaces
  • Red: Bathrooms and high‑risk areas
  • Yellow: Polishing and delicate surfaces
  • White: Glass and electronics

For home use, you can adopt a similar system to avoid using the same cloth on your toilet and your kitchen counter.

Choosing the Right Cloth for Each Surface and Task

Using the correct microfiber cloth for the job is essential for optimal results and to avoid damaging surfaces.

Glass and Windows

For streak‑free glass, you need a low‑GSM (100‑150) cloth with a tight weave. Look for a glass‑specific microfiber cloth that is lint‑free and does not leave behind fibers. Use it dry or with a small amount of glass cleaner; the cloth will trap dirt and polish the surface to a brilliant shine.

Electronics and Screens

TV screens, laptop displays, and smartphone screens are delicate and easily scratched. Always use a soft, low‑GSM microfiber cloth designed for electronics. Avoid cloths with abrasive textures or high GSM, as they may leave marks. A 120‑150 GSM cloth with a smooth weave is ideal.

Automotive Detailing

Car paint requires a plush, high‑GSM cloth (350+) to prevent swirl marks. For drying, choose a waffle‑weave microfiber that absorbs water quickly and leaves no streaks. For waxing and polishing, a thick, plush cloth (400+ GSM) is recommended.

Kitchen and Countertops

Medium‑GSM cloths (200‑250) are perfect for wiping down counters, cleaning stovetops, and drying dishes. They offer good absorbency and are durable enough to handle grease and food residues.

Bathroom and Tile

For bathroom surfaces, a medium to high‑GSM cloth (250‑350) works well. It can tackle soap scum, water spots, and grime. Consider using a color‑coded cloth to keep it separate from kitchen cloths.

Furniture and Wood

For dusting wood furniture, a medium‑GSM cloth with a soft, non‑abrasive texture will lift dust without scratching the finish. A slightly damp cloth can pick up more dust without leaving water spots.

Microfiber Cloth Care: How to Wash and Maintain for Longevity

Microfiber cloths are durable, but improper washing can ruin their performance. Follow these guidelines to keep your cloths in top condition.

Do NOT Use Fabric Softener

Fabric softeners coat the fibers with a waxy layer that blocks the split‑fiber structure, reducing the cloth's ability to trap dirt and absorb moisture. This is the most common mistake that ruins microfiber cloths.

Wash with Like Colors

Separate cloths by color to prevent dye transfer. Wash them with other microfiber items, not with cotton or other fabrics that can shed lint.

Use Mild Detergent

A standard, liquid laundry detergent without bleach, softeners, or heavy perfumes is best. Use a small amount—too much detergent can leave residue.

Wash in Cold or Warm Water

Hot water (above 140°F / 60°C) can damage the fibers. Stick to cold or warm cycles.

Air Dry or Low Heat

High heat will melt the fine fibers. Air drying is ideal, but if you use a dryer, set it to the lowest heat setting and remove the cloths while they are slightly damp.

When to Replace

Over time, even well‑cared‑for microfiber cloths lose their effectiveness. If the cloth no longer picks up dirt easily, leaves lint, or feels stiff, it is time to replace it. A good cloth should last 300‑500 washes with proper care.

Common Mistakes to Avoid When Using Microfiber Cloths

Even the best cloth can underperform if used incorrectly. Here are the most frequent errors and how to avoid them.

Using the Same Cloth for Everything: Cross‑contamination is a real risk, especially between kitchen and bathroom. Use color‑coded cloths or label them to prevent mixing.

Washing with Cotton: Cotton lint will stick to microfiber, making the cloth less effective and causing it to leave lint on surfaces.

Using Fabric Softener: As noted, this destroys the cloth's cleaning ability.

Overloading the Washer: Cloths need room to agitate and rinse thoroughly. Wash in small batches.

Using Too Much Detergent: Residue from excess detergent can clog fibers and reduce performance.

Bleaching: Bleach degrades the polyamide fibers, weakening the cloth.

Using on High‑Heat Surfaces: Microfiber can melt on hot cooktops or engine parts. Always allow surfaces to cool before using microfiber.

Environmentally Friendly: Why Microfiber Outperforms Disposable Wipes

The environmental impact of cleaning products is a growing concern. Single‑use paper towels and disposable wipes contribute to deforestation and landfill waste. A reusable microfiber cleaning cloth can last for hundreds of uses, drastically reducing waste. One study found that switching from disposable wipes to reusable microfiber cloths can reduce cleaning costs by up to 80% and cut waste by over 90%.

Moreover, because microfiber cloths can clean effectively with just water, they reduce the need for chemical cleaners, which are often toxic and packaged in single‑use plastic containers. For eco‑conscious consumers, microfiber is a clear win.

Frequently Asked Questions About Microfiber Cleaning Cloths

What is a microfiber cleaning cloth?

A microfiber cleaning cloth is a textile made from ultra‑fine synthetic fibers, typically a blend of polyester and polyamide. These fibers are split to create microscopic wedges that trap dirt, absorb liquids, and polish surfaces without scratching.

How do I choose the right microfiber cloth for different tasks?

Consider the GSM (weight) and weave. Low GSM (100‑150) is best for glass and screens; medium (200‑250) for general cleaning; high (300‑400) for heavy‑duty and drying; ultra‑high (400+) for professional detailing.

Can I use microfiber cloths on all surfaces?

Microfiber is safe for most surfaces, including glass, metal, plastic, wood, and painted surfaces. However, avoid using them on very hot surfaces and always choose the appropriate GSM and texture for delicate materials.

Do microfiber cloths scratch surfaces?

High‑quality microfiber cloths are non‑abrasive and will not scratch when used properly. Always ensure the cloth is clean and use gentle pressure. Some industrial cloths may have abrasive textures, so check the label.

Can I wash microfiber cloths in the washing machine?

Yes, but avoid fabric softener, bleach, and high heat. Wash with like colors, use a mild detergent, and air dry or tumble dry on low.

How often should I replace my microfiber cloths?

With proper care, a good microfiber cloth can last through 300‑500 washes. Replace them when they lose absorbency, stop picking up dirt, or show visible wear.

Can I use microfiber cloths with cleaning chemicals?

Yes, but they are most effective with water alone. Some chemicals may degrade the fibers, so check compatibility. For best results, use pH‑neutral cleaners.

What is the best microfiber cloth for glass?

A low‑GSM (100‑150) cloth with a tight weave, designed specifically for glass, will give streak‑free results.

Can microfiber cloths be used in the kitchen?

Absolutely. They are great for wiping counters, drying dishes, and polishing stainless steel. Use a color‑coded cloth specifically for kitchen use to avoid cross‑contamination.

Are all microfiber cloths the same quality?

No. Quality varies based on fiber blend, split ratio, GSM, and manufacturing process. Cheap cloths may be made from unsplit fibers or low‑quality materials that are less effective.

Can microfiber cloths remove bacteria?

Yes, studies show that microfiber cloths can remove up to 99% of bacteria from surfaces using just water, making them highly effective for sanitization.

What is the difference between a waffle weave and a terry cloth microfiber?

Waffle‑weave cloths have a raised grid pattern that increases surface area, making them more absorbent and ideal for drying. Terry‑style cloths are thicker and better for polishing and applying products.

Can I use a microfiber cloth on my car's paint?

Yes, but use a high‑GSM (350+) plush cloth to avoid swirl marks. Wash the cloth frequently to prevent dirt from scratching the paint.

Why do my microfiber cloths leave lint?

Lint often occurs when the cloth is worn out, has been washed with cotton, or has lost its split‑fiber structure. It can also happen if the cloth is of low quality.

Can I use microfiber cloths on eyeglasses?

Yes, but choose a very soft, low‑GSM cloth designed for optics. Avoid pressing too hard to prevent scratching the lens coatings.
